The <br />City has such an ordinance in place. <br /> <br />This program does not increase the supply of housing. <br />47: Create tools that require residency for <br />housing, to incentivize home <br />ownership over investor-acquisition of <br />housing units. <br /> Since the 2008 recession, many of the houses that went <br />into foreclosure were purchased by investors and then <br />rented out. Some investors are able to outbid <br />homebuyers, making it difficult for households to <br />purchase homes. While there are ways to incentivize <br />this, there are no legal mechanisms to require it. <br />48. Preserve “naturally occurring” <br />affordable housing. <br /> There is no legal mechanism to do this. If a home- <br />owner wants to fix-up or even “flip” a run-down home, <br />the city cannot realistically stop this. <br />49.
